2017-06-23 26 views
0

簡体字中国語を値-zh-rCN、zh、繁体字中国語の値-zh-rTWに入れました。しかし、ロケールを変更すると、常にzHから文字列がロードされます。ここで私はどのようにロケールを変更しています。Android簡体字中国語と繁体字中国語は使用できません

public void setLanguage(String languageCode, String countryCode){ 
    Locale locale = new Locale(languageCode, countryCode); 
    Locale.setDefault(locale); 
    Configuration config = getResources().getConfiguration(); 

    if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.N) { 
     setSystemLocale(config, locale); 
    } else { 
     setSystemLocaleLegacy(config, locale); 
    } 
    BaseSharedPreference.getInstance().setLanguage(locale.getLanguage()); 
    recreate(); 
} 

答えて

-1
中国語

、Andorid以下と以上7.0は、詳細については、かなり異なっている、あなたはこの記事を見ることができますLink

関連する問題